Jeezy & Master P Unite For “Gone”

Holy s**t, my 90’s and millennium self got a chance to cross paths today!


Jeezy and Master P are certainly legendary rappers. However, in this day and age, they aren’t artists I would consider poppin’. Whatever the case may be, the two decided to join forces for “Gone” — a trill ass track that features a royal trap instrumental and rowdy/braggadocios bars by both southern rappers.

I like the energy attached to this song a lot! Both Jeezy and Master P hurl out their bars like they recorded their verses at the back of a VIP section. Even though I have less than 300 dollars in my savings account right now, I felt rich listening to these dudes rap.

Master P and Jeezy literally sound the same on this song.

 

OVERALL RATING (4/5)
